Master Anxieties
The fundamental fears and anxieties that dominate or significantly influence an individual's personality and actions throughout different stages of life.
Freud
Sigmund Freud, an influential neurologist and founder of psychoanalysis, known for his theories on the unconscious mind and psychosexual development.
Erikson
Erik Erikson, a developmental psychologist known for his theory on the psychological development of humans at different stages of life.
Conduct Problems
Behavioral issues in children and adolescents that involve defiance, aggression, and rule-breaking.
